You shouldn't, however, use this ingredient as a substitute for white or brown sugar, say our experts. 5 Types of Sugar That Are Better Alternatives to Refined Sugar The word "turbinado" is a Spanish-American derivative of the word turbinea machine used to process sugar. This includes pressing juice from the sugarcane, which is boiled in large steam evaporators to form crystals and spun in a turbine to remove liquid molasses (10).
